RODNEY HAMILTON
**** ****** *****, ******** *******, CO 80920
719-***-**** ~ ***************@*****.***
TECHNICAL EXPERIENCE
OS: Linux/Unix (BSD, Red Hat, Ubuntu), Shell Scripting, Windows XP, 7.
Java: core and j2ee, JSP, Spring, Hibernate, MVC design, JFC/Swing, JDBC.
Web Services: Axis 2, SOAP UI, Oxygen, WSDL, XSLT, Jersey
Languages: C/C++, Object Pascal, Java, XML, XSLT, HTML, PL/SQL, javascript, PHP.
Databases: ORACLE, Postgres, MySQL, PL/SQL, MongoDB, data modeling.
Application Servers: JBoss, Tomcat, Weblogic
Javascript: jQuery, json, ajax
Other: Interpersonal and communication skills. Self Starting, Team oriented. Organizational skills.
CAREER HISTORY
Software Developer, BAE Systems 2014-present
Develop software and scripts to automate tedious, error-prone manual processes.
Meet with billing department employees to understand their processes so the software can be designed and implement to specifications.
Develop, test, and debug software in a linux environment, and write bash scripts to customize these tasks.
Manage code base in ClearCase and JIRA.
Software Developer, Utilities International 2013-2014
Travel out of state to customer sites to provide technical support for functional consultants.
Develop java desktop (Web Start) application using core, j2ee, and swing java libraries.
Design re-usable frameworks, optimize existing code, locate and fix coding defects.
Software Developer, Intelligent Software Solutions 2005-2013
Designed and implemented object oriented java client database applications in a large integrated project environment using IntelliJ, Eclipse, and Oracle.
Collaborated with Subject Matter Experts and users to work out and finalize requirements to optimize development time and deliver quality software to customer satisfaction.
Worked in a deadline oriented agile driven team environment.
Organized and prioritized tasks as an independent self-starter to optimize productivity, allocate time to tackle technical challenges, and to meet deadlines and take on additional unforeseen tasks.
Software Developer, L3 Communications 2002-2005
Performed requirements gathering duties from internal customers and created high level UML models (Use Cases, Sequence diagrams, data models)..
Designed and implemented client-server database applications that tracked and analyzed satellite tracking station repair and maintenance utilizing Clear Case, SQL* plus, PL/SQL Developer, and ORACLE in a busy team environment.
Designed and developed Java Struts applications conforming to the MVC architecture utilizing JBuilderX, JBoss, and JDBC, and javascript.
Used XML for automated transfer of data from one database through a firewall to a database on another domain. Also used XML to meet application configuration needs.
Developed, tested, and maintained software throughout entire lifecycle.
Software Developer, Agilent Technologies 2000-2002
Designed and implemented Object-Oriented client-server software for a voice quality tester product in a team environment utilizing Visual C++ and MFC;
Fixed software defects detected through thorough testing.
Exercised strong problem solving skills inherent in software implementation..
EDUCATION
Bachelor of Science, Computer Science, North Dakota State University,1999